2005 Chrysler 300 vs. 2007 Seat Leon
To start off, 2007 Seat Leon is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Chrysler 300.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Chrysler 300 would be higher. At 3,516 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Chrysler 300 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Chrysler 300 (250 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 102 more horse power than 2007 Seat Leon. (148 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Chrysler 300 should accelerate faster than 2007 Seat Leon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Chrysler 300 weights approximately 449 kg more than 2007 Seat Leon.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2005 Chrysler 300 (340 Nm) has 140 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Seat Leon. (200 Nm). This means 2005 Chrysler 300 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Seat Leon.
Compare all specifications:
2005 Chrysler 300 | 2007 Seat Leon | |
Make | Chrysler | Seat |
Model | 300 | Leon |
Year Released | 2005 | 2007 |
Body Type | Sedan |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 3516 cc | 1984 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 250 HP | 148 HP |
Engine RPM | 6400 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 340 Nm | 200 Nm |
Engine Bore Size | 96 mm | 82.5 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 81 mm | 92.8 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 9.9:1 | 11.5:1 |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1709 kg | 1260 kg |
Vehicle Length | 5010 mm | 4320 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1890 mm | 1770 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1490 mm | 1460 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3190 mm | 2580 mm |
Fuel Consumption Overall | 10.7 L/100km | 7.9 L/100km |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 68 L | 55 L |
